What are some common challenges faced by gutter installers on the job?

Gutter installers often encounter challenges such as working at heights, handling heavy or awkward materials, and adapting to varying weather conditions. Additionally, each property presents unique rooflines and structures, requiring problem-solving and precise measurements for a proper fit. Effective communication and coordination with homeowners and other construction professionals are also important, as these ensure smooth project completion and customer satisfaction.

What does a Gutter Installer do?

A Gutter Installer is responsible for measuring, cutting, and installing gutters on residential or commercial buildings to ensure proper water drainage. They help protect properties from water damage by directing rainwater away from roofs and foundations. The job involves working with materials like aluminum, steel, or vinyl, and often requires the use of ladders, hand tools, and safety equipment. Gutter Installers may also remove old gutters, perform repairs, and provide maintenance services as needed.

What Is a Gutter Installer?

A gutter installer installs rain gutters in primarily residential settings. In this job, you are responsible for measuring, cutting, and sealing the gutters during installation to ensure rainwater does not collect near the home after running down the downspouts. You must understand different types of roofing and how to attach gutters for the most efficiency, without necessitating removal of the roofing. Your duties revolve around getting the right gutters for the project and ensuring they are installed correctly and up to code with any city or state laws, which may include obtaining a permit for the installation from the local government body.

LeafGuard Installer

An installer will work and train under the supervision of our current Production Manager (PM). The role of an installer includes but is not limited to: customer service, installation, site cleaning, and truck inventory. 

In 1993, after years of intense product research and development, Englert, Inc. introduced the LeafGuard brand gutter, a patented one-piece leaf and debris shedding gutter system. The LeafGuard gutter system revolutionized the industry by providing an innovative one-piece system for residential and commercial application, with a lifetime, clog-free guarantee. Today, the LeafGuard brand continues to be a trusted source for quality and reliability, backed by the Good Housekeeping seal.
